Cherrystone Auctions Sale: 1120

United States
United States Postmasters' Provisionals Baltimore,

Sale No: 1120
Lot No: 2100
Symbol: e
Cat No: 3X3

Sign up for the Provenance Catalog (here.)

image 1845 5c black on bluish paper, pos. 10, with frameline showing on three sides, pen cancels, used on FL to Northampton NY, with red Baltimore postmark at left, straight line "Paid" handstamp and manuscript "Due 5", v.f. example of this rare Provisional, with 1998 PFC, cat. $13500 (Cat No. 3X3) (Image)

Cat. $13500, Est.$9,000

Opening US$ 8,500.00


Closed..Nov-10-2020, 10:03:43 EST
Sold For 0


United States Postmasters' Provisionals St. Louis,

Sale No: 1120
Lot No: 2101
Symbol: e
Cat No: 11X2

Sign up for the Provenance Catalog (here.)

image 1846 10c black on greenish, margins all around, tied by red "St. Louis Mo. Dec 18" town postmark on FL datelined "St. Louis, December 17/45", addressed to Messrs. P. A. Breithau New York, with matching straight line "Paid" and "Paid 10" by pen at upper right, minor soiling and filing folds away from the stamp which is v.f. (listed as cover number 27 on the Faiman census), with 1972 Wolfgang Jakubek, 1974 Willy Balasse and 2019 Philatelic Foundation certificates, handstamped John F. Seybold (purple handstamp on reverse), also ex-Erivan, cat. $14000 (Cat No. 11X2) (Image)

Cat. $14000, Est.$10,000

Opening US$ 10,000.00


Closed..Nov-10-2020, 10:04:02 EST
Sold For 0
